Kingscote is a town located in the region of Kangaroo Island. This is the largest city on this region off the seas of South Australia with around 1,200 residents. This is a popular tourist destination and is the oldest European settlement in South Australia.
Tourists would be interested to visit the Bay of Shoals Wines. This is situated north of Kingscote and is the place of South Australia’s first dwellers. The first vines were sowed on the sides of the hills back in 1993. These are pruned manually and the grapes are actually picked by hand. One’s visit to Kingscote would be incomplete if the Hope Cottage Museum is not toured. This is one of the three authentic cottages built in the city back in 1856. It has an extensive collection of various items which illustrates Kingscote’s early settlements. It includes photographs, memorabilia, and history of the pioneers, among others.
Island Beehive is for animal lovers. One would discover the life of Ligurian bees by visiting this site. One can tour the production factory and taste organic honey made onsite. There is a shop inside that offers tourists a chance to take home some bee products such as candles and other souvenirs.

Nature lovers would enjoy spending time in the Kangaroo Island Marine Centre. This is an unusual center wherein their penguin and aquarium tours are done every evening on the Kingscote Wharf. This tour offers a walk in the shore in the colony of the Fairy penguins and there is also a talk regarding the astonishing sea water aquariums. This center offers a wide variety of fish and other marine animals. There is a retail shop at the building’s frontage which tourists could avail of souvenirs and other products.
